How they compare
Albania currently reports 130 against 129.9 in Uganda, a difference of 0.1.
Across all 30 years both countries report, Albania has been ahead every year.
Albania ranks 36th and Uganda ranks 38th of 179 countries.
Albania has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Albania | Uganda |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 130.6 | 123.86 | 6.74 | Albania |
| 1990s | 128.95 | 126.42 | 2.53 | Albania |
| 2000s | 129.61 | 128.89 | 0.72 | Albania |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
